Application of the donor-acceptor concept to intercept low oxidation state group 14 element hydrides using a Wittig reagent as a lewis base
Swarnakar, Anindya K.,McDonald, Sean M.,Deutsch, Kelsey C.,Choi, Paul,Ferguson, Michael J.,McDonald, Robert,Rivard, Eric
, p. 8662 - 8671 (2014/10/15)
This article outlines our attempts to stabilize the Group 14 element dihydrides, GeH2 and SnH2, using commonly employed phosphine and pyridine donors; in each case, elemental Ge and Sn extrusion was noted. However, when these phosphorus and nitrogen donors were replaced with the ylidic Wittig ligand Ph3P=CMe2, stable inorganic methylene complexes (EH2) were obtained, demonstrating the utility of this under-explored ligand class in advancing main group element coordination chemistry.
